Output 8703d3c8954973839b95b408202cda39207758db01fabbc634f6269624046dea:1

value
21636907
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b198ef4a48640e36bf2346f75458d4075beffe80 OP_EQUALVERIFY OP_CHECKSIG
address
1HC3p3cnGtkcvhFPyvYu5VApmgGbxaAzW9
transaction
8703d3c8954973839b95b408202cda39207758db01fabbc634f6269624046dea
spent
true